But it’s really expensive, and that makes it … WebNuke flares are implemented as a donut-like shape. They have three radii: • The outer radius is the outside of the donut. • The middle radius is the thickest part. • The inner radius is where the donut hole would be. You can define two colors for the flare: the color of the donut itself and the fill color for the donut hole.

WebCurveTool. You can use this node to analyze and track the following aspects of the input sequence: • the size and position of black areas in the sequence. • average pixel values in the sequence. • exposure changes in the sequence, and. • brightest and dimmest pixels in the sequence.
